Artist Simon Femandez is behind this clever outdoor advertisement for sun lotion. The billboard is covered in a 1 million tiny beads which reveals hidden artwork featuring a sunbathing woman when hit by sunshine. Femandez was hired by Brazilian ad agency Click Isobar for the project.

Band of Skulls vocalist and bassist Emma Richardson has explored a new creative outlet by releasing her first solo exhibition Crusin’ for a Bruisin’, a series of drawings and large-scale work created in response to her bands music. The artwork is currently showing at the Londonewcastle Project Space in London.

French artist Philippe Pasqua has taken human skulls and adorned them with materials including silver and gold leaf, butterflies and tattoos. Eerie and disturbing to some, strangely beautiful to others.

These oversized pencils are made of Parmesan cheese and have ‘lead’ that contains the flavours of truffle, pesto and chilli. The product, made by German ad agency Kolle Rebbe, even comes with a sharpener. The perfect talking point for a stifled dinner party conversation.

This is Australian fashion designer Emma Mulholland’s second collection ever (if you count her graduation show) and she has pulled it together like a pro. The colourful collection makes strong references to surf culture and throws in touches of rave, tribal and psychedelic influences.
